THE Department of Interior and Local Government (DILG) said Friday the woman who skipped the mandatory quarantine in a Makati hotel may have infected “about 15” people with COVID-19.
In an interview on Teleradyo, Interior Secretary Eduardo Año confirmed that a certain Gwyneth Chua, a traveler from the US, went out of her hotel while under mandatory quarantine and had dinner in a restaurant.
She had a swab taken Dec. 26, Año said, a “clear” indication that Chua violated protocols. She later tested positive for COVID-19.
“Yung problema, yung mga nakasama niya sa dinner and sa bar, ay mga nagpa-positive na rin… Ang sabi lang about 15 yung nagpa-positive. We need to confirm that,” said Año.
“Kung omicron case ‘to, huwag naman sana. Kasi ang bilis talaga kung omicron… Magpa-test na lang,” he said later on.
It is not immediately clear if these were the people she was within the dinner or the party. More people, however, are coming out with information on the matter, Año said.
The investigation is still ongoing but CCTV footage confirmed that the woman got out of the quarantine facility, he added.
“Ang mga ka-party niya, marami na ring nag-positive noon. Marami na ring may symptoms doon. We still don’t know if it is omicron because hindi pa, wala pang result yung genome sequencing niya,” he explained.
Authorities have visited the establishments Chua went to and their personnel have been interviewed, Año said.
“Very cooperative naman sila, pinakita na rin nila yung CCTV footage sa ating CIDG investigators.”
